The working principle of automotive artificial leather mainly includes three main types: PVC artificial leather, PU artificial leather and microfiber artificial leather. Each type has its own unique production process and characteristics.

PVC artificial leather
The main raw material of PVC artificial leather is polyvinyl chloride (PVC), and its production process includes coating method and calendering method. The coating method is to coat PVC plastisol on the pretreated fabric base, and then make it through plasticizing, embossing, cooling, winding and other processes. The calendering method is to mix PVC resin with plasticizer, apply paste on the base fabric by roller coating, and then make it through thermal compounding, plasticizing, foaming and other processes12. The advantages of PVC artificial leather are simple production and low cost, but the disadvantages are airtightness, hard feel, poor comfort and poor aging resistance.

PU artificial leather
The main raw material of PU artificial leather is polyurethane (PU), and its production process includes wet method and dry method. The wet method is to mix PU with solvent, impregnate or coat it on the base fabric, and replace the solvent with water to form a porous film. The dry method is to mix PU resin with filler and then apply it to the base fabric through a scraper or roller. PU artificial leather has good air permeability and feel, but poor wear resistance and high production cost 23. High-end PU artificial leather is even more expensive than genuine leather and is closer to the texture of natural leather.

Microfiber artificial leather
Microfiber artificial leather (microfiber leather) is a composite of microfiber non-woven fabric and PU resin. Its production process includes weaving microfiber non-woven fabric, then impregnating the fabric in PU resin, and then making it through coagulation, washing, post-treatment and other processes. Microfiber artificial leather has excellent wear resistance, cold resistance, air permeability and aging resistance, but the manufacturing cost is high and the process is complicated .

Environmental protection and application scenarios
PVC artificial leather has poor environmental protection due to the use of chemical materials, and is often used in economical products. PU artificial leather is usually more environmentally friendly than PVC, and has a softer feel and better air permeability, so it is more popular in some application scenarios .
